## Account Recovery — Userline Split

While carving the user module out of the Brindlewood monolith, recovery flows temporarily route through the legacy gateway. If a release leaves accounts stranded mid-migration, pause the cutover, re-enable the legacy session table, and verify replication lag is under two seconds. Before unlocking the recovery console, confirm the change window with operations, then supply the passphrase printed below.

recovery phrase for bawep-kawef: oliath-casdor

**Handover — Dorrit House Lease**

To incoming director. Renegotiation with the landlord, Calver Estates, is mid-stream. We hold a break clause in eighteen months; use it as leverage. Target: 12% rent reduction plus fit-out contribution. Next meeting already scheduled. Do not signal we intend to stay. The confidential note below explains why.

board note of bawep-tajef: Queniusek Systems plans to raise the Quenvan list price by 53.1 percent in March. The pricing group signed off on a budget of $176.4 million for Project Drueth. The renewal with Casionix Partners closes at $142.5 million a year, 8.3 percent below the last contract. Project Fraax slips by six weeks because of the tooling delay.

# Transmatic Farm — Environments

The Transmatic transcoding farm runs three environments: sandbox (Eastmere rack, synthetic jobs only), staging (mirrors production codec profiles at one-tenth scale), and production (the Dunharrow cluster). Promotion between environments requires a green soak run of at least six hours. Note that staging shares its queue broker with production, so load tests must be coordinated. Each environment boots with the configuration below.

deployment values, yadug-bawif:
[framir]
team = pelox
access_code = ac_a38ab2
owner = tamion.julael
host = framir.tolvaqlabs.test
port = 11211
peer = tammir.zemvargrid.local
salt = 2215ef03
pin = 1541

Loyalty Overhaul — Branch Managers Only

Heads up: the Copperleaf Rewards scheme is getting a full rebuild this autumn. Points will convert to the new Ember credits at 2:1, and the tier thresholds drop slightly to keep regulars happy. Expect some grumbling at the tills in week one — crib sheets are coming. Branches in Marsden Vale pilot first. The thinking behind all this is summarised just below.

internal memo for kaduf-baduf: Only 35 of the 378 pilot accounts renewed Holir, so a churn review is set for June 11. Eliielax Group is in early talks to buy Silaelix Group for about $142.1 million.